ABB 70EI05a-e Speed Input Module (Industrial-Grade Tachometer Signal Processor)

The ABB 70EI05a-e (Part Number: HESG447427R0001) is an industrial signal conditioning module engineered for precision speed measurement in motor control applications. Designed to interface with both analog tachometers and digital encoders, this module delivers filtered, amplified speed feedback signals essential for closed-loop VFD systems, servo drives, and process automation platforms.

Manufacturing facilities running multi-motor synchronization, web tension control, or dynamometer test stands face a common challenge: raw tachometer signals contain electrical noise, mechanical vibration artifacts, and non-linear characteristics that degrade control loop performance. The 70EI05a-e solves this by providing advanced filtering, configurable scaling, and fault detection—transforming unreliable sensor outputs into stable 0-10V analog signals with ±0.5% accuracy and sub-10ms response time.

Built in the United States with industrial-grade components rated for 0-60°C operation, this module integrates seamlessly into ABB drive systems and third-party controllers. Whether you're retrofitting legacy DC tachometer systems or implementing new encoder-based feedback loops, the 70EI05a-e delivers the signal integrity required for high-performance motion control.

Core Features & Technical Advantages

✓ Dual-Mode Input Flexibility
Accepts both analog DC tachometer signals (0-100 VDC) and digital encoder pulse trains (up to 100 kHz). High input impedance (>100 kΩ) prevents loading effects on tachometer generators, while quadrature decoding supports A/B channel encoders with directional sensing. This versatility eliminates the need for separate conditioning modules when upgrading from tachometer to encoder feedback.

→ Precision Signal Conditioning Pipeline
Integrated filtering removes commutator ripple (50-500 Hz), EMI interference, and vibration-induced noise without sacrificing response time. Configurable low-pass filter cutoff (1-100 Hz) balances noise rejection against control bandwidth requirements. Linearization lookup tables compensate for non-linear tachometer V/RPM characteristics, ensuring measurement accuracy across the full speed range.

• High-Accuracy Speed Measurement
±0.5% full-scale accuracy maintains tight speed regulation in closed-loop systems, reducing energy consumption by 15-25% compared to open-loop V/Hz control. Fast <10ms update rate enables high-bandwidth control loops for dynamic applications like paper machine section drives and test stand dynamometers operating at variable acceleration rates.

✓ Intelligent Fault Detection & Diagnostics
Continuous monitoring of signal integrity detects tachometer open circuits, encoder power failures, and out-of-range conditions. Alarm outputs integrate with PLC/SCADA systems for predictive maintenance, preventing unplanned downtime from sensor failures. Zero-speed detection with programmable threshold supports safe motor startup sequences.

→ Industrial Environmental Resilience
Operates reliably in harsh factory environments with temperature extremes (0-60°C), electrical noise, and vibration. EMC compliance (IEC 61000-6-2/6-4) ensures coexistence with VFDs, welders, and other high-power equipment. Conformal coating protects circuitry from humidity, dust, and chemical exposure in textile mills, steel plants, and paper facilities.

• Configurable Scaling & Calibration
Adjustable gain and offset parameters match diverse tachometer constants (mV/RPM to V/RPM) and encoder resolutions (100-10,000 PPR). Field-calibratable zero and span adjustments enable precise matching to drive controller input specifications without external signal converters, reducing installation complexity and cost.

Typical Application Scenarios

Variable Frequency Drive (VFD) Closed-Loop Control
In pump, fan, and compressor applications, the 70EI05a-e provides speed feedback for VFD vector control algorithms. By closing the speed loop, the module enables precise flow/pressure regulation independent of load variations, reducing energy consumption in HVAC systems, water treatment plants, and industrial ventilation by 20-30% compared to constant-speed operation. The fast response time tracks rapid load changes without overshoot.

Multi-Section Paper Machine Synchronization
Paper mills require synchronized speed control across press, dryer, and calendar sections to maintain web tension within ±0.5% tolerance. The 70EI05a-e conditions tachometer signals from each section drive, feeding master-slave control systems that prevent web breaks and quality defects. At line speeds exceeding 1200 m/min, the module's 10ms response captures transient speed variations during grade changes and threading operations.

Steel Rolling Mill Elongation Control
Hot and cold rolling mills use the module to measure roll surface speed for calculating material elongation and maintaining gauge accuracy. Integration with mill automation systems enables adaptive speed ratio control between roughing and finishing stands. Fault detection prevents catastrophic equipment damage from tachometer failures during high-speed threading (up to 25 m/s strip velocity).

Textile Spinning & Weaving Speed Regulation
Ring spinning frames and air-jet looms depend on precise spindle/main shaft speed control to maintain yarn tension and fabric quality. The 70EI05a-e's noise rejection capability is critical in electrically noisy textile environments with hundreds of motors operating simultaneously. Individual spindle speed feedback enables electronic drafting systems that improve yarn uniformity and reduce breakage rates by 15-20%.

Engine & Motor Dynamometer Test Systems
Performance test facilities use the module to measure shaft speed during transient acceleration tests, load sweeps, and endurance runs. The high accuracy supports precise torque calculation (torque = power / speed), while dual-input capability allows redundant measurement using both tachometer and encoder for cross-validation. Data logging integration captures speed profiles for emissions certification and durability analysis.

Selection Criteria:

  • Choose tachometer mode for legacy DC generator feedback systems (typical in older VFD retrofits)
  • Select encoder mode for new installations requiring directional sensing and higher resolution
  • Verify tachometer voltage output matches module input range (use voltage divider if >100 VDC)
  • Confirm encoder pulse frequency at maximum speed does not exceed 100 kHz limit
  • Match filter cutoff frequency to application bandwidth (lower for steady-state processes, higher for dynamic servo systems)
  • Ensure 24 VDC power supply can provide 500 mA continuous current with adequate margin

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can the 70EI05a-e interface with both AC and DC tachometer generators?
A: The module is designed for DC tachometer signals (permanent magnet generators producing DC voltage proportional to speed). For AC tachometers (typically 3-phase synchronous generators), an external AC-to-DC converter is required. Contact our application engineers for recommended converter models compatible with your specific tachometer.

Q: What is the maximum cable length between the tachometer and the 70EI05a-e module?
A: With proper shielded twisted-pair cable (22 AWG minimum), distances up to 100 meters are achievable without signal degradation. For longer runs (>100m), use a local signal repeater or consider switching to encoder-based feedback which is less susceptible to voltage drop and noise pickup over extended cable runs.

Q: How does the module's filtering affect control loop response time in high-bandwidth servo applications?
A: The configurable filter cutoff allows balancing noise rejection against response speed. For servo systems requiring >50 Hz control bandwidth, set the filter to maximum cutoff (100 Hz) which introduces <2ms additional delay. The module's inherent 10ms response time is suitable for most industrial servo applications; ultra-high-speed systems (>100 Hz bandwidth) may require direct encoder-to-controller interfaces.

Q: Is the 70EI05a-e compatible with absolute encoders or only incremental types?
A: The module processes incremental encoder pulse trains (A/B quadrature signals). Absolute encoders with pulse output modes (simulated incremental) are compatible. For native absolute encoder protocols (SSI, BiSS, EnDat), use ABB's dedicated absolute encoder interface modules from the AC800M I/O family.

Q: What energy efficiency improvements can be expected when upgrading from open-loop to closed-loop VFD control using this module?
A: Field data from HVAC and pump applications shows 15-25% energy reduction when implementing closed-loop speed control versus open-loop V/Hz operation. Actual savings depend on load profile variability—applications with frequent load changes (variable flow pumps, batch processes) achieve higher savings than constant-load applications (conveyor drives, fixed-speed fans).

Q: Does the module require periodic recalibration, and what is the recommended calibration interval?
A: The 70EI05a-e uses stable precision components with <0.1% drift per year. For non-critical applications, annual calibration verification is sufficient. Process industries with ISO 9001 or FDA compliance requirements should perform calibration every 6-12 months using traceable reference speed sources.
